This spacious co-op at 400 East 17th Street offers the rare combination in Brooklyn real estate: a flexible, converted layout and significant private outdoor space. Located in the heart of Ditmas Park, this home perfectly balances mid-century charm with modern adaptability. The Residence: Indoor Flexibility Meets Outdoor Luxury
Originally a generous one-bedroom, this unit has been reconfigured to provide a dedicated second room perfect for a home office, nursery or guest space without sacrificing the flow of the main living area.
Massive Private Patio: Step out onto your own sprawling terrace; an incredible extension of the living space. Whether you're hosting summer dinner parties, urban gardening, or enjoying a quiet morning coffee, this level of outdoor space is a true rarity in the neighborhood. The Layout: The primary bedroom remains an oasis of calm with ample closet space. The secondary room is versatile and bright, with enough room for another bedroom, office set-up or flex space. Living & Dining: A wide entry foyer leads into a sun-drenched living room with plenty of space for a full seating arrangement. Classic Finishes: Original hardwood floors, open layout, and West-facing windows that fill the space with natural light. Built in 1962, 400 East 17th Street is a meticulously maintained, elevator-serviced cooperative that offers a suite of essential amenities:
Security: Part-time doorman, full-time superintendent, porter, and a modern ButterflyMX video intercom system. Convenience: On-site laundry room, bike storage, and a package room. Parking: On-site garage (subject to a waitlist) Pet Policy: Cat-friendly (strictly no dogs). The Neighborhood: Ditmas Park Magic
Less than a block away from the vibrant Cortelyou Road , the neighborhood's commercial heartbeat.
Dining & Drinks: Moments from local favorites like Cafe Madeline, Catskill Bagel Co., CorTHAIyou, and Sycamore Bar & Flower Shop. Shopping: Year-round Sunday Farmers Market and the Flatbush Food Co-op. Transit: The Q train at Cortelyou Road is just one block away, offering a swift commute to Manhattan. Greenspace: Directly North takes you to the southern entrance of the Parade Grounds and Brooklyn's Backyard: Prospect Park . Please note: there is an assessment in place for the duration of 2026 of $326.16 per month.
